Conduct of normal childbirth
You are at the end of your pregnancy, you lose water or you experience painful contractions and close it’s time to leave for maternity. From your arrival at the facility in your room with your baby, this is what happens.
The arrival at the maternity
Upon your arrival, a midwife is your constant (voltage, temperature) and considers the cervical dilation. She puts on your arm a catheter to be used in cases of infusion and install two sensors in your stomach that monitoring records uterine contractions and the baby’s heart.
The early work
You are then installed in work room. You can get up and do exercises with a ball.
Every hour, a midwife measure cervical dilation and takes your constants. Of regular monitoring can estimate a healthy baby.
Gradually the contractions become more frequent and painful.
Namely: if the expansion is too slow, your baby may suffer. The wise woman you are given a product to accelerate the frequency and intensity of contractions. The contractions can cause vomiting.
Epidurals
The cervix is dilated to 3 cm: it offers the epidural you will give birth without pain. An anesthetist practice then a sting in your back, place a catheter into the spine and injects the anesthetic: your pain fade in 10 minutes.
Once the epidural placed, you can not move, eat or drink. You are under continuous monitoring.
Namely: You can request the epidural until 7 or 8 cm dilated. Make up your time!
Expulsion
When the cervix is fully open, it fades away undertakes baby and you feel an urge to push. This expulsion.
The midwife then install the brackets at the end of the bed to elevate your legs.
You should push strongly to the rhythm of contractions. This stage lasts about half an hour. The portion of the head is the hardest, then the body comes alone. Sometimes you make an incision of the perineum (episiotomy) to prevent tearing.
Namely: the gynecologist obstetrician is called in case of complications, if any need to use forceps or suction cups to help your baby out.
The issue
Your baby is born but it is not finished: it is the placenta. This phenomenon usually occurs without effort 20 to 30 minutes later.
Baby First Aid
Immediately after birth, your spouse can cut the cord.
A medical team takes care of your baby and unclog his airway by suctioning the mucus in his nose and mouth. Your baby is weighed and examined from every angle! Fontanelle, hips, genitals, shoulders, abdomen … The midwife then took his temperature and it takes a few drops of blood.
Once dressed and his ID bracelet in place, your puppy may find your arm.
Namely: we often measure the baby the next day.
And the mother?
Meanwhile, you are not forgotten! The most important thing is to check that all the placenta was expelled. The stitches are made in cases of episiotomy. After two hours of monitoring, you regain your room with your baby.
These are: the average labor lasts 12 hours for women giving birth to their first child and 8 hours for others.
